Spanish Tutor in Los Angeles
with
Clinton Alexander Bullock

Please see also see Spanish Tutor and Private Lessons in Beverly Hills, West Hollywood, Santa Monica, Los Angeles for the resume of another Spanish tutor.

Clinton currently provides private Spanish lessons in Los Angeles.  As a former assistant professor of Spanish at the United States Defense Language Institute, he is experienced and provides high quality instruction to individuals and corporations.  He also provides group Spanish class in Los Angeles upon request.
